    Product review:

    Skin type- acne prone, slightly dry skin

    Climate- hot and humid

    Skincare routine- kiku lotion, cosrx snail mucin, torriden dive in booster, tret twice a week, Kiku emulsion, skinfood Shea cream lotion

    Age- mid 20’s

    Ingredients-
    Aqua (Water), Butylene Glycol, Glycerin, Caprylic/Capric Triglyceride, 1,2-Hexanediol, Lonicera Japonica (Honeysuckle) Flower Extract, Artemisia Annua Extract, Sodium Hyaluronate, Camellia Sinensis Leaf Extract, Ceramide NP, Acetic Acid, Ammonium Acryloyldimethyltaurate/VP Copolymer, Glyceryl Stearate, Acrylates/C10-30 Alkyl Acrylate Crosspolymer, Arginine, Octyldodecanol, Ethylhexylglycerin.

    Review-
    I started using tret a few months ago and I needed a soothing cream for when my skin was sensitive. I love the pyunkang yul ceramide lotion so I wanted to try this out.

    The texture is very lightweight and it blends into the skin easily. It’s not watery and has a gel like viscosity to it. It has a very soothing and cooling effect on my face when it’s sensitive/inflamed from tret. This is my go to for when my face is stinging after using other products. It instantly calms the stinging.

    It’s a lovely lightweight moisturizer, but it’s not enough for my tret skin so I usually top it off with a heavier cream during my night time routine. But it would be perfect as a daytime moisturizer for warmer weather. I love the pyunkang yul brand as their products are so calming and perfect for sensitive skin, I love this and I try to use it sparingly as I like it so much that I want to save it. I know it’s silly as I could always buy another tube.

    Final verdict – great lightweight moisturizer for summer and calming gel for inflamed skin. WRP
